Blackrock MuniYield Pennsylvania Quality Fund (MPA), a closed-end fund focused on investment-grade Pennsylvania municipal bonds that deliver tax-exempt income for eligible investors, is trading at $11.3 as of 2026-04-20, posting a slight 0.09% gain in today’s session.
